Bug 217850 - [WinCairo] sluggish page scrolling for wheel events since r268499
Summary: [WinCairo] sluggish page scrolling for wheel events since r268499
Status: RESOLVED FIXED
Alias: None
Product: WebKit
Classification: Unclassified
Component: Scrolling (show other bugs)
Version: WebKit Nightly Build
Hardware: Unspecified Unspecified
: P2 Normal
Assignee: Fujii Hironori
URL:
Keywords: InRadar
Depends on:
Blocks:
 
Reported: 2020-10-16 15:20 PDT by Fujii Hironori
Modified: 2020-10-18 22:19 PDT (History)
2 users (show)

See Also:


Attachments
Patch (1.75 KB, patch)
2020-10-18 13:58 PDT, Fujii Hironori
no flags Details | Formatted Diff |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Fujii Hironori 2020-10-16 15:20:57 PDT
[WinCairo] sluggish page scrolling even in non-AC mode

1. Start WinCairo MiniBrowser
2. Go to https://trac.webkit.org/wiki
3. scroll down by mouse wheel

r267199 (with WebKitRequirements v2020.08.20): smooth scrolling
r268564 (with WebKitRequirements v2020.10.04): sluggish scrolling
Comment 1 Simon Fraser (smfr) 2020-10-16 19:44:59 PDT
Test around r268287, r268417, r268476, r268499.
Comment 2 Fujii Hironori 2020-10-18 13:08:56 PDT
It's a very useful information for bisecting. Thank you.

r268498 : smooth scrolling
r268499 : sluggish scrolling

This issue has been started since r268499.
Comment 3 Fujii Hironori 2020-10-18 13:58:05 PDT
Created attachment 411718 [details]
Patch
Comment 4 Fujii Hironori 2020-10-18 13:59:05 PDT
I don't understand this change, but I confirmed this patch fixes the WinCairo issue.
Comment 5 Fujii Hironori 2020-10-18 22:18:43 PDT
Comment on attachment 411718 [details]
Patch

Clearing flags on attachment: 411718

Committed r268664: <https://trac.webkit.org/changeset/268664>
Comment 6 Fujii Hironori 2020-10-18 22:18:46 PDT
All reviewed patches have been landed.  Closing bug.
Comment 7 Radar WebKit Bug Importer 2020-10-18 22:19:18 PDT
<rdar://problem/70427879>